Fred Lewis Motter, Jr., 97, passed away peacefully of natural causes on February 1, 2026, at English Meadows Assisted Living in Harrisonburg, Virginia.
Born May 1, 1928, in York, Pennsylvania, Fred lost his mother, Helen Bolton, five days later from delivery complications. He was raised by his father, Fred Sr. and stepmother, Emily Garey, alongside his younger sister, Fay. Growing up, Fred excelled in basketball, swimming, golf, and tennis, and developed a lifelong love of music after accidentally watching a film about composer Franz Schubert.
Fred graduated from William Penn Senior High School in 1947 and joined the Army, achieving the rank of Corporal before his honorable discharge in 1950. He then enjoyed a three-decade career in federal government service, with overseas assignments in Cyprus, Iran, Lebanon, Laos, Thailand, and Italy, and stateside tours in Washington, D.C., and Miami.
Known for his kindness and steadfast friendship, Fred developed a passion for sailing that he pursued well into his 80s. He married his first wife, Peggy Grainer, in 1957, adopting her daughter and later raising four children.
Fred retired following his final assignment in Rome, where he spent nearly twenty years making wine and olive oil and sailing the Mediterranean. He later fulfilled a lifelong dream by sailing across the Atlantic and winning his class in an Annapolis-to-Bermuda race.
Fred is survived by his wife of ten years, Joan Duncan; four children, four grandchildren; seven great-grandchildren, and extended family. He was preceded in death by two wives and close family members.
